Dr Jason Pallant from Swinburne University of Technology and Dr Louise Grimmer from the University of Tasmania present 'Shopology', the retail podcast that covers the latest news, trends, and insights in retail and consumer marketing.
In this episode:
- The latest retail news headlines including
- ABS sales figures for September
- Click Frenzy
- Woolworths sales boom attributed to COVID-19 and the Ooshies promotion
- This week's interview features David Grant from Brickfields Consulting in conversation with Jason.
- New segment: A bargain, a rip-off and a gift with purchase - Louise and Jason select something good, something bad and something unexpected from the world of retailing.
